22 Tons: E-Excavator for More Sustainable Construction Site

Summary by Kronen Zeitung
In the construction of a large PV plant in Kühtai, the exporting companies rely on electrified equipment and short distances. Among other things, a 22-tonne electric excavator is used. In addition to hydroelectric power, photovoltaic systems are a central building block for Tyrol to achieve the goal of energy autonomy by 2050, as the "Krone" reported.
